Position Summary
Operations & Maintenance Supervisor plans and coordinates the activities of technicians engaged in the inspection, maintenance and repair of peaking power plant equipment such as gas turbine engines, generators, diesel engines, air compressors, water treatment systems, motors, and pumps by performing the following duties.
Reports To: Plant Superintendent
Work Location: 4646 White Walnut Rd., Pinckneyville, Illinois 62274
Pay Range- $50.00/hour- $60.00/hour
Position Responsibilities
- Provide for the training of and supervise a roving team of mechanical and instrument/electrical technicians
- Ensures the safe and timely completion of all preventative, predictive and corrective maintenance activities
- Plans and schedules routine, emergent, regulatory compliance and planned outage tasks in accordance with plant contracts, ERCOT and other requirements as applicable
- Ensure accurate and complete documentation of maintenance activities in the plant CMMS and outage reports
- Assists workers in diagnosing malfunctions in machinery and equipment
- Directs workers in electrical, controls and mechanical maintenance and repair of plant equipment
- Generate and/or reviews purchase orders for parts and services, ensuring budgetary constraints are maintained
- Identify and optimize proactive maintenance techniques to optimize reliability of assets
- Execute and document effective Root cause Analysis and oversee the implementation of corrective actions
- Interprets company policies to workers and enforces safety programs and regulations
- Reads and interprets technical manuals, specifications, drawings, control logic and P&ID/F&IDs to aid in troubleshooting and execution of repair
- Recommends and implements measures to improve reliability and equipment performance
- Identifies and implements changes in work procedures and use of equipment to increase efficiency
- Performs activities of workers supervised as needed
- Supervises all preventative and corrective maintenance to ensure it is completed in accordance with technical manual procedures and sound engineering principles
- Recommend, maintain and secure adequate spare parts inventory
- Capable to operate equipment locally when needed
- After hour call out to the site as required
- At least 3-5 years of experience working in a power plant environment.
- Must be able to speak, read, and write English fluently.
- US work authorization is a precondition of employment. The company will not consider candidates who require sponsorship for a work-authorized visa.
- Successful candidate will need to satisfactorily complete pre-employment drug screen and background check.
- Technical competence including understanding software, hardware, networks, etc.
- 5 years of LM6000 plant experience preferred.
- Must be willing to accept call outs to the site when needed.
- Ability to interface with customers
